Iowa library’s Teen Central celebrating 5 years

COUNCIL BLUFFS, Iowa (AP) – The Council Bluffs Library is celebrating the upcoming fifth anniversary of Teen Central, a place where youths can study and socialize. A library worker tells The Daily Nonpareil that Teen Central has increased how many programs it offers since opening in 2010. She says Teen Central began hosting between three and four programs a year. It now holds about four a week.

Teen Central is housed on the library’s second floor. The Teen Services manager says it was created to fill a needed gap in providing an educational area specifically for teenagers.  The center is open seven days a week and officials say about 60 youths visit daily during the school year. Around 500 teens participate each month in the weekly programs.
